Lighthouse Maths

Lighthouse Maths is a professional learning program that explores transformational approaches in maths education to equip primary educators with powerful strategies and techniques to elevate their maths teaching practice through mastery of the proficiencies.

The Lighthouse Maths program develops the capability of primary teachers as leaders in structured inquiry maths approaches, with a focus on the use of problem solving and reasoning techniques to develop a deeper conceptual understanding of maths through challenging tasks.

Through workshops, coaching and networking sessions with peers the program aims to empower primary educators with a tool kit to enhance their teaching practice and improve student engagement and achievement in maths.

Through the support of Chevron, the Lighthouse Maths program is currently provided for free over the course of a year to select schools in the Perth metro region.
